Senator Kipchumba Murkomen has gotten mad with ODM for the expulsion of MPs Aisha Jumwa and Suleiman Dori following the meeting by the party’s NEC.
According to Murkomen, ODM is blowing hot and cold as their own party leader Raila Odinga was first to cross the bridge through the handshake by embracing President Kenyatta of Jubilee Party. As such, he feels that the 2 MPs should not be punished for embracing Deputy President William Ruto.

In a tweet, he concurred to the controversial Lawyer Miguna Miguna who stated that Jumwa and Dori had not supported any other party but instead it is Raila who had supported Jubilee Party openly.




Senator Murkomen further said that ODM Party doesn’t belong to Hon Rail Odinga but to the people. According to him, Jumwa and Dori did not go to Uhuru Park to swear themselves-in.

Murkomen said that the reason ODM is behaving this way is to scare members who are ready to depart from the party.




He says that ODM should embrace the handshake fully and not frustrate its members for supporting other candidates.
